Location and Opening Hours

The Museum of Illusions is located in Stuttgart and is easily accessible via public transportation. The exact address is:

Alexanderstraße 4
70184 Stuttgart, Germany

The museum is open daily from 10:00 am to 8:00 pm.

Accessibility

The Museum of Illusions is wheelchair accessible, and there are elevators available to move between floors.

An Insider’s Guide to Stuttgart, Germany

Stuttgart, the capital of the state of Baden-Württemberg in southwest Germany, is a vibrant city that offers a unique blend of modern life and traditional culture. It is home to many world-class museums, delicious cuisine, and some of Germany’s most stunning natural landscapes. With so much to see and do, here is an insider’s guide to making the most of your visit to Stuttgart.

Must-Visit Attractions in Stuttgart

1. The Mercedes-Benz Museum – This museum is perfect for car enthusiasts, showcasing the evolution of one of the world’s most iconic luxury car brands. The museum is divided into different eras, each with its own themes and interactive exhibits.

2. The Stuttgart State Gallery – For art lovers, this museum is home to an impressive collection of European art from the 14th to the 21st century, including works by Monet, van Gogh, and Picasso.

3. Königstraße – Stuttgart’s main shopping boulevard, which offers a wide variety of shops, cafes, and restaurants.

4. The Stuttgart Wine Trail – For a unique experience, take a walk along this trail that winds through Stuttgart’s vineyards and offers stunning panoramic views of the city.

Dining Spots in Stuttgart

Stuttgart’s culinary scene is known for its traditional Swabian cuisine, which includes dishes like Spätzle (German noodles), Maultaschen (German dumplings), and Flammkuchen (German-style pizza). Here are a few must-try restaurants:

1. Zum Kuckuck – This cozy restaurant serves traditional Swabian dishes with a modern twist. Try their Maultaschen and Flammkuchen variations!

2. Weinstube Schellenturm – A traditional tavern-style restaurant located in a historic tower, offering an authentic Swabian dining experience.

3. Cube Restaurant – This Michelin-starred restaurant offers contemporary cuisine in a stunning setting with panoramic views of the city.

Cultural Experiences in Stuttgart

Stuttgart has a rich cultural history, with many museums and events that showcase its history, art, and music. Here are a few cultural experiences not to be missed:

1. The Stuttgart Opera – The Stuttgart Opera House is one of the largest and most renowned opera houses in Europe, with a program that includes both classic and contemporary works.

2. State Museum of Natural History – This museum offers an extensive collection of fossils, minerals, and live animals. It’s a great place to visit for kids and adults.

3. The Stuttgart Ballet – Known worldwide for its innovative choreography, The Stuttgart Ballet is a must-see for any dance fan.

Local History in Stuttgart

Stuttgart has a rich history that dates back to the Roman era. Here are some of the best ways to learn about the city’s history:

1. Altes Schloss – One of the oldest buildings in Stuttgart, this castle houses a museum showcasing the city’s history and culture from the 13th century to the present.

2. State Museum Württemberg – This museum explores the history of Baden-Württemberg and is located in one of Stuttgart’s oldest buildings.

3. Fernsehturm Stuttgart – This television tower provides incredible views over the city and a revolving restaurant. A visit to the tower’s museum will take you through its construction and history.

Off-the-Beaten-Path Suggestions in Stuttgart

If you’re looking for something a little different, here are a few suggestions that are off the beaten path:

1. Market Hall – A foodie heaven, this indoor market offers a wide variety of local and international delicacies to explore.

2. Wilhelma Zoo & Botanical Garden – Positioned in a lovely park-style setting, this zoo is home to numerous exotic animals and offers a variety of themed botanical gardens.

3. Karlshöhe – This nature reserve provides a natural setting in the city, with plenty of space to hike and bike, and a panoramic view of Stuttgart from the hill.
